Precautions for carbonization furnace in charcoal production
In charcoal production, the carbonization furnace is the key equipment for carbonizing wood. Here are a few key steps in charcoal production:
Raw material preparation:
First of all, wood raw materials suitable for carbonization need to be prepared. Commonly used wood materials include teak, oak, pine and so on. The raw material should have the proper moisture and size, and usually needs to be cut and stacked for a period of time to make it suitable for entering the carbonization furnace for processing.
Carbonization Furnace Loading:
The prepared wood raw materials are loaded into the carbonization furnace. Charring furnaces usually have opening and closing loading doors for easy loading and unloading of wood. The loading of raw materials should pay attention to the appropriate stacking density and uniformity to ensure the uniformity and high efficiency of the carbonization process.
Carbonization process:
After loading the wood, the carbonization furnace starts the carbonization process. This is a process that takes place in a high temperature, low oxygen environment. The wood in the carbonization furnace is pyrolyzed under high temperature conditions, the volatile substances in it are released, and the wood fiber structure is gradually transformed into a carbonaceous structure. This process requires strict control of the temperature, oxygen supply and other parameters in the carbonization furnace to ensure the quality and efficiency of carbonization.
Carbonization time:
Charring time depends on the type of wood, humidity, design of the charring furnace, and the desired final charcoal quality. Typically, the charring process takes hours to days. During this process, the temperature and atmosphere conditions in the carbonization furnace need to be continuously monitored and adjusted to ensure the smooth progress of carbonization.
Carbonization furnace cooling and unloading:
After the carbonization process is completed, the carbonization furnace needs to be cooled. The purpose of cooling is to reduce the temperature inside the carbonization furnace to ensure safe discharge operation. Once the charring furnace has cooled to a sufficient temperature, the charcoal can be removed from the charring furnace. The charcoal taken out needs further processing, such as sieving, crushing and packaging, etc. to obtain the final charcoal product.
